Hyaluronic Acid-PEG Hydrogel Synthesis

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
The 8-arm poly(ethylene glycol) (8-arm PEG, hexaglycerol core, Mw = 20,000) was acquired from Jenkem Technology (Allen, Texas, USA) and purified before use by dissolution in dichloromethane and precipitation in cold diethyl ether. Hyaluronic acid sodium salt (Mw = 15–25 kg/mol) was purchased from Contipro. The polymer was dried by lyophilization overnight before use. p-Nitrophenyl chloroformate (PNC, 96%) was purchased from Sigma-Aldrich (Zwijndrecht, the Netherlands) and was sublimated before use. Anhydrous dimethylformamide (DMF, 99.8%), tyramine (99%), anhydrous pyridine (99.8%), hydrogen peroxide (H2O2, 30 wt% in H2O), lithium chloride and HRP (261 U/mg) were obtained from Sigma-Aldrich and used without further purification. dichloromethane (stabilized by Amylene, ≥99.9%), ethanol (99.8%) and diethyl ether (stabilized by BHT, ≥99.5%) were obtained from Biosolve (Valkenswaard, The Netherlands) and used as received. Dialysis membranes (Spectra/Por molecular porous membrane tubing 6, MWCO: 1 kDa) were acquired from Spectrum Laboratories, Inc. (Breda, The Netherlands) and rinsed with distilled water before use. Deuterated solvents were purchased from Aldrich. Phosphate buffered saline (PBS, 150 mM, pH 7.4) was purchased from Gibco Life Technologies Ltd (Paisley, UK).
